Public Notice: Solid Waste Management Program Local Enforcement Agency (LEA)

PUBLIC NOTICE IS HEREBY GIVEN, in compliance with AB1497 and California Code of Regulations(CCR), Title 27 Section 21660.3, that the Sonoma County Department of Health Services, Solid WasteLocal Enforcement Agency (LEA) is processing a Registration Permit for the City of Santa Rosa.Please be advised that the Sonoma County LEA received and accepted for filing a Registration Permit fora Medium Volume Transfer/Processing Facility located at 35 Stony Point Rd. Santa Rosa, CA 95401. TheLEA has determined the Registration is complete and correct, as per Title 14 of the California Code ofRegulations (CCR) Section 18104.1. The LEA is certified by the California Department of Resources,Recycling and Recovery (CalRecycle) to enforce state laws and regulations at solid waste sites withinSonoma County, including Medium Volume Transfer/Processing Facilities. Amended Notice of Public Hearing Sonoma County Housing Authority PHA Administrative Plan Changes

The Sonoma County Community Development Committee, in its capacity as the governing body of the Sonoma County Housing Authority, will hold a public hearing on August 20, 2025, at 10:00 a.m. in the hearing room of the Sonoma County Community Development Commission located at 141 Stony Circle, Suite 210, Santa Rosa, CA. Sonoma County Probation Supports Special Olympics!

On March 1, 2025, Probation staff participated in the Sonoma County Polar Plunge at Doran Beach which raised a total of $54,345 for local Special Olympic athletes.  Probation won the best costume contest dressed as unicorns. Read full story
